Florian Fainelli wrote: > I noticed that some zsh users who forced their ls formatting to something non > standard could not generate the initramfs file list. Forcing the locale to C > while generating seems not to be enough. Adding --time-style=locale will use > C locale ls output and will let them generate the initramfs list. It has no > side effects for other users.
